 Livingston Philanthropies, Inc. (LPI) founder Jeff Friedman invites Livingston residents to “join their neighbors in providing for the homeless, profoundly poor and disenfranchised, especially during the pandemic.” Friedman, who was preparing to leave for Newark with a load of new coats, gloves, hats, diapers, men’s socks and items from cleaners, said, “Philanthropic residents can find sales on Amazon or other websites and ship directly to LPI World Headquarters (my garage). Or, you can drop items themselves without contact.” Friedman may be contacted at njhomeless@aol.com or 973-533-9336.
